miércoles, 1 de diciembre de 2010

Thumbnails Reescalables en php

<*?
// Creo la imagen desde el archivo fuente, qeu en este caso es una web cam
$src = imagecreatefromjpeg('http://www.rtve.es/imagenes/siglo-21-novedades/1291121922061.jpg');

//la imagen de destino, como es fondo de pantalla por ejemplo 100px alto y ancho. $imagendestino = imagecreatetruecolor(100, 100);

//Pillar el tamaño de la imagen
$imgAncho = imagesx ($src); $imgAlto =imagesy($src);

//Reescala
imagecopyresampled($imagendestino, $src, 0, 0, 0, 0, 100, 100, $imgAncho, $imgAlto );


//En el caso de que la quiera guardar...
//imagejpeg($imagendestino,'/imagenes/fondo.jpg');

//Sólo imprimirla

Header("Content-type: image/jpg"); imagejpeg($imagendestino);

?*>

Para recortar la imagen solo puedes ver mi post anterior.
Thumbnails recortado en php

Web con una librería interesante para crear thumbnails

Librería para thumbnails

No hay comentarios:

Publicar un comentario